What Herbs Go Well With Lamb Chops?

What herbs go well with lamb chops?

Rosemary’s earthy aroma pairs perfectly with the richness of lamb chops, creating a harmonious culinary experience. Its pungent flavor complements the robust meat, enhancing its natural flavors without overpowering them. Thyme’s delicate fragrance contributes a subtle herbal note, balancing the intensity of the lamb and adding a touch of complexity. Oregano’s robust character adds a touch of warmth and pungency, complementing the savory lamb chops and creating a tantalizing aroma. Basil’s sweet and herbaceous flavor adds a refreshing balance to the earthy flavors of the lamb, creating a harmonious and satisfying dish.

What wine pairs well with lamb chops?

Succulent lamb chops demand a wine companion that enhances their robust flavor. Cabernet Sauvignon, with its bold tannins and complex notes of dark fruit, stands as an exceptional choice. Its robust structure complements the chops’ richness, while its tannins contribute a pleasing astringency that balances the meat’s fattiness. For a more elegant pairing, Pinot Noir’s lighter body and delicate flavors of red fruit and spices offer a harmonious union. Its subtle tannins provide structure without overwhelming the chops’ delicate nature. Alternatively, Merlot’s velvety texture and notes of plummy fruit and herbs create a harmonious balance with lamb’s savory flavors.

How can I make a simple marinade for lamb chops?

Gather your ingredients: olive oil, lemon juice, fresh herbs (such as rosemary, thyme, or oregano), salt, and pepper. Whisk together the olive oil and lemon juice in a bowl. Finely chop the herbs and add them to the marinade.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Place your lamb chops in a glass or ceramic dish. Pour the marinade over the lamb chops, ensuring they are fully coated.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to overnight. The longer you marinate the lamb chops, the more flavorful they will be. When you’re ready to cook the lamb chops, remove them from the marinade and pat them dry. Brush lightly with olive oil and season with additional salt and pepper, if desired. Grill or pan-sear the lamb chops to your desired doneness. Rest the lamb chops for 5-10 minutes before slicing and serving.

What vegetable side dishes pair well with lamb chops?

Roasted vegetables are a classic and flavorful accompaniment to lamb chops, providing a sweet and caramelized balance to the savory meat. Roasted carrots, parsnips, and onions all pair well with lamb, as they caramelize nicely in the oven and develop a slightly smoky flavor. For a more earthy and rustic side dish, consider roasted root vegetables such as beets, rutabagas, or turnips. These vegetables have a slightly sweet and nutty flavor that complements the richness of the lamb. If you prefer a lighter and more refreshing side dish, a simple green salad with a tangy vinaigrette can provide a nice contrast to the richness of the lamb. Alternatively, a creamy polenta or mashed potatoes can add a smooth and comforting element to the meal.

How can I add a Middle Eastern twist to lamb chops?

Infuse your lamb chops with the vibrant flavors of the Middle East by marinating them in a fragrant blend of yogurt, garlic, cumin, coriander, and mint. Grill them until beautifully charred, and serve with a tantalizing tahini sauce infused with the zesty brightness of lemon and the aromatic warmth of smoked paprika. Accompany your delectable chops with a flavorful side dish of couscous, studded with sweet raisins and toasted almonds, and a refreshing salad of crisp cucumbers and tomatoes tossed in a tangy dressing of sumac and olive oil. Finish off your culinary journey with a sweet and aromatic dessert of baklava, its layers of flaky pastry filled with a rich mixture of chopped nuts and sweetened with honey.

What dessert pairs well with lamb chops?

Lamb chops, with their savory and slightly gamey flavor, deserve a dessert that complements their richness without overpowering them. One classic option is a simple fruit tart, with a flaky crust filled with fresh berries or stone fruits. The sweetness of the fruit balances the meatiness of the lamb, while the tart crust provides a textural contrast. Another excellent choice is a light and airy mousse, such as a raspberry or chocolate mousse. The delicate texture of the mousse complements the tender lamb, and the sweetness of the fruit or chocolate adds a touch of indulgence. For a more decadent dessert, try a rich chocolate ganache tart or a creamy cheesecake. These desserts provide a luxurious contrast to the savory chops, creating a truly indulgent experience.

Can I grill lamb chops for a barbecue?

Lamb chops are a delicious and versatile cut of meat that can be grilled to perfection. They are relatively thin, so they cook quickly and evenly. The key to grilling lamb chops is to keep them moist and flavorful. To do this, you can marinate them in a flavorful sauce or rub them with spices before grilling. You can also add a glaze to the chops towards the end of grilling to give them a sweet and sticky flavor. Lamb chops can be served with a variety of sides, such as rice, potatoes, or vegetables. They are also a great addition to a barbecue platter.

Are there any vegetarian options to pair with lamb chops?

Lamb chops, succulent and savory, are often enjoyed with traditional meaty sides. However, for those seeking a vegetarian alternative that complements the rich flavors of lamb, there are several delectable options. Roasted root vegetables, such as carrots, parsnips, and sweet potatoes, bring earthy sweetness and caramelized notes that pair harmoniously with the lamb’s robust taste. Grilled or steamed asparagus adds a delicate crunch and fresh flavor profile, providing a light and refreshing contrast. Ratatouille, a classic Provencal stew, offers a vibrant medley of eggplant, zucchini, tomatoes, and peppers, adding a burst of colors and textures to the plate.
